The GTA Double Pack for $9.98 might have my name on it. Yes, I'm one of the 41 gamers in North America who didn't finish GTA III or GTA VC. I played the hell out of GTA III on the PS2 but never finished it. Did more of the random drive-arounds to cause as much mayhem as I could. 
Top Spin at $10 is appealing, too. A horrible online game but a very good offline game if you have time to play an entire set. No in-game saves -- ugh!
I'm also curious about Pirates, too.
